Obituary of Ryan K. Cullen

Ryan K. Cullen, 32, of Albany, formerly of Amsterdam, took his last ride on March 21st with his devoted family by his side. Ryan enjoyed the wind on his face; whether he was on one of his motorcycles or in his cherished truck. After graduating from Amsterdam High School he went to MMI in Phoenix, AZ along side his father. Since then he has worked at Spitzie's then Broadway Choppers where he fixed, repaired and built custom bikes, his true passion. Most recently he worked at Railex in Schenectady while he was building his own custom bike shop, RC Customs. Ryan had a unique gift to know and understand the bikes he worked on and if something wasn't right he could fix it. He loved tinkering in the garage and knew how to fix anything. He enjoyed a few trips with his family to Yankee Stadium, and took many memorable vacations down to Florida to visit his grandparents. Ryan and his siblings also took many mini vacation camping trips to different locations. The boys also enjoyed their golf outings, Ryan enjoyed hunting, fishing and ice fishing with his father, brother, uncle Chris, Turkeyman Chris and brother-in-law Rich. Ryan met the love of his life Katey a few years ago and have been inseparable ever since. They enjoyed the outdoors and took long rides on the bike and in Ryan's truck. Ryan was never without a smile or a joke. He had a great heart and would do anything for a friend. He loved kids and enjoyed spoiling his niece Ryenne and nephews Justin, Matthew and Cody. It was a privilege and honor to know him. Ryan is survived by his wife Katey, his parents Dan and Dana Cullen, his brother Brandon Janel Cullen, his sister Shannon Relyea Rich, his sister Meghan Richie Altieri, his niece Ryenne and nephew Justin. His grandmother Betty Heaney, His mother and father-in-law, Ann Nolan and John Neet, sister in law Tara Bess Jimmy, nephews Cody and Matthew. He has a host of Aunts, Uncles and cousins and those who just loved him. Ryan truly had a soft spot for strays. His beloved dog Gabby found Ryan at Broadway Choppers and has been his faithful companion since. Ryan's strength and memory will live on forever.
